Pope Francis wants to change translation of the Lord’s Prayer
Pope Francis has called for a new translation of the Our Father, the most popular prayer in Catholicism, saying the phrase “lead us not into temptation” mischaracterizes God. “That is not a good translation,” the pontiff said in Italian during a television interview Wednesday night. “It is not He that pushes me into temptation and then…
